Mexican Federal Highway 63

Mexican Federal Highway 63

Highway in Mexico


Federal Highway 63 (Carretera Federal 63) (Fed. 63) is a toll-free part of the federal highway corridors (los corredores carreteros federales) of Mexico.[4] The highway connects the cities of Matehuala, San Luis Potosí and Mexquitic, San Luis Potosí.
